From 24f3c1e90a3b63c49e522abf1e323a7dfd834618 Mon Sep 17 00:00:00 2001 From: kyubeom Date: Sat, 17 Aug 2024 12:25:35 +0900 Subject: [PATCH] =?UTF-8?q?#2=20Food=20->=20Meal=20=EC=9A=A9=EC=96=B4=20?= =?UTF-8?q?=EB=B3=80=EA=B2=BD?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../main/kotlin/com/core/adapter/in/web/MealController.kt | 7 +++---- .../kotlin/com/core/adapter/in/web/dto/AdapterMealDto.kt | 7 +++---- .../application/domain/meal/service/MealReadService.kt | 2 +- .../kotlin/com/core/application/port/in/GetMealUseCase.kt | 2 +- .../com/core/application/port/in/dto/ApplicationMealDto.kt | 2 +- 5 files changed, 9 insertions(+), 11 deletions(-) diff --git a/core/src/main/kotlin/com/core/adapter/in/web/MealController.kt b/core/src/main/kotlin/com/core/adapter/in/web/MealController.kt index 2ae8948..937762c 100644 --- a/core/src/main/kotlin/com/core/adapter/in/web/MealController.kt +++ b/core/src/main/kotlin/com/core/adapter/in/web/MealController.kt @@ -2,19 +2,18 @@ package com.core.adapter.`in`.web import com.core.adapter.`in`.web.dto.AdapterMealDto import com.core.application.port.`in`.GetMealUseCase -import com.core.application.port.`in`.dto.ApplicationMealDto import com.core.common.response.ApplicationResponse import org.springframework.web.bind.annotation.GetMapping import org.springframework.web.bind.annotation.RestController -@RestController("/api/v1/foods") +@RestController("/api/v1/meals") class MealController(private val getMealUseCase: GetMealUseCase) { @GetMapping - fun getFood() : ApplicationResponse> { + fun getMeal() : ApplicationResponse> { val data = getMealUseCase.execute() - val toResponse = AdapterMealDto.GetFoodRes.toResponse(data) + val toResponse = AdapterMealDto.GetMealRes.toResponse(data) return ApplicationResponse.ok(toResponse) } diff --git a/core/src/main/kotlin/com/core/adapter/in/web/dto/AdapterMealDto.kt b/core/src/main/kotlin/com/core/adapter/in/web/dto/AdapterMealDto.kt index c3acc5a..bd204bb 100644 --- a/core/src/main/kotlin/com/core/adapter/in/web/dto/AdapterMealDto.kt +++ b/core/src/main/kotlin/com/core/adapter/in/web/dto/AdapterMealDto.kt @@ -1,20 +1,19 @@ package com.core.adapter.`in`.web.dto import com.core.application.port.`in`.dto.ApplicationMealDto -import java.time.LocalDateTime class AdapterMealDto { - data class GetFoodRes( + data class GetMealRes( val idx: Long, val type: String, val status: String, val meals: String ) { companion object { - fun toResponse(data: List) : List{ + fun toResponse(data: List) : List{ return data.map { - GetFoodRes( + GetMealRes( idx = it.idx, type = it.type, status = it.status, diff --git a/core/src/main/kotlin/com/core/application/domain/meal/service/MealReadService.kt b/core/src/main/kotlin/com/core/application/domain/meal/service/MealReadService.kt index 1f55dff..241fee1 100644 --- a/core/src/main/kotlin/com/core/application/domain/meal/service/MealReadService.kt +++ b/core/src/main/kotlin/com/core/application/domain/meal/service/MealReadService.kt @@ -7,7 +7,7 @@ import org.springframework.stereotype.Service @Service class MealReadService : GetMealUseCase { - override fun execute(): List { + override fun execute(): List { TODO("Not yet implemented") } diff --git a/core/src/main/kotlin/com/core/application/port/in/GetMealUseCase.kt b/core/src/main/kotlin/com/core/application/port/in/GetMealUseCase.kt index 528298a..e750e1b 100644 --- a/core/src/main/kotlin/com/core/application/port/in/GetMealUseCase.kt +++ b/core/src/main/kotlin/com/core/application/port/in/GetMealUseCase.kt @@ -4,6 +4,6 @@ import com.core.application.port.`in`.dto.ApplicationMealDto interface GetMealUseCase { - fun execute(): List + fun execute(): List } \ No newline at end of file diff --git a/core/src/main/kotlin/com/core/application/port/in/dto/ApplicationMealDto.kt b/core/src/main/kotlin/com/core/application/port/in/dto/ApplicationMealDto.kt index d263817..370597d 100644 --- a/core/src/main/kotlin/com/core/application/port/in/dto/ApplicationMealDto.kt +++ b/core/src/main/kotlin/com/core/application/port/in/dto/ApplicationMealDto.kt @@ -5,7 +5,7 @@ data class ApplicationMealDto ( val price: Int, val description: String ) { - data class GetFoodRes( + data class GetMealRes( val idx: Long, val type: String, val status: String,